Pratham Software (PSI) is a global IT company that helps clients propel through digital transformation across businesses, offering solutions in Product Engineering, BPM, Data analytics, BI, etc.

We're looking for a Senior Software Engineer who takes ownership seriously, someone who designs solutions, ships them, and stands behind them in production. You'll work across a technically interesting stack on systems that process millions of provider records. This is a role with real scope: you'll influence architecture, shape engineering practices, and work directly with product and leadership to solve hard problems in a domain that genuinely matters.

Responsibilities:

  • Healthcare's provider data problem is a hard distributed systems problem. Hundreds of primary sources, state boards, payers, and federal registries, each with their own schema, SLA, and failure mode. Downstream, real credentialing and network decisions depend on whatever truth we can surface.
  • API contract stability at velocity. You're building a platform hundreds of integrations depend on. How do you evolve a Quarkus/REST API, adding resources, deprecating fields, and shifting data models without breaking consumers? Contract-first design, versioning strategy, and backward compatibility aren't theoretical here. Integration reliability at scale. Upstream sources go down, change schemas, and return dirty data. You'll build the patterns that absorb that chaos: idempotent consumers, dead-letter queues, circuit breakers, and reconciliation pipelines on top of Kafka and Spanner.
  • Entity resolution on messy real-world data. Deduplicating and reconciling provider records across hundreds of heterogeneous sources, where a wrong merge has downstream consequences. MDM patterns, confidence scoring, and deterministic vs. probabilistic matching at scale.
  • AI-augmented velocity without regression. We use Cursor and Claude Code as force multipliers. The engineering problem is building review culture, eval frameworks, and test coverage that keeps quality high as output volume increases.
  • Observability for a data platform, not just a service. Uptime isn't enough; you need to know when a provider record is stale, inconsistent, or wrong. You'll instrument data quality and lineage, not just p99 latency.
